Eggs marks the spot! - Chile's Buin Zoo marks Easter Sunday with treat hunt to promote food search behaviours

"Chile’s Bioparque Buin Zoo, had its animals search for their food hidden in Easter eggs as part of the Easter Sunday celebrations. Located in the commune of Buin, the zoo is the largest in Chile housing more than 2,000 animals of various species. Footage shows animals searching for food inside Easter eggs and packets in their enclosures, while dozens of visitors take photos of them. Director of Bioparque Buin Zoo, Ignacio Idalsoaga, explained the exercise aims to help the animals develop important life skills while also entertaining visitors, particularly children. "It is part of our ongoing work to do what we call environmental enrichment, to create situations where they have to search for food in a slightly more difficult way. To make them perform natural food-search behaviours and today with the theme of the little eggs," he indicated. Idalsoaga added that the zoo’s lions receive ostrich eggs filled with meat, while herbivores mark the resurrection with relevant treats, like fruit. "As a family it is an alternative way to share the occasion, among nature, and for the children to enjoy this experience in a place as pleasant as Buin Zoo," said visitor Francisco Solar.
